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/azure/11.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Visual studio Azure通知中心使用标记测试发送_Visual Studio_Azure_Push Notification_Azure Notificationhub_Azure Management Portal - Fatal编程技术网

Visual studio Azure通知中心使用标记测试发送

Visual studio Azure通知中心使用标记测试发送,visual-studio,azure,push-notification,azure-notificationhub,azure-management-portal,Visual Studio,Azure,Push Notification,Azure Notificationhub,Azure Management Portal,VisualStudio和Azure管理门户都具有发送测试推送通知的功能 当我做广播时,一切正常。但当我尝试用标签发送时,什么也没发生 我试图通过.NET对象发送带有特定标记的消息,它也可以正常工作,标记列表和标记表达式都可以正常工作 string tagsExpr = "mytag"; NotificationHubClient hub = NotificationHubClient.CreateClientFromConnectionString(notificationHubConne

VisualStudio和Azure管理门户都具有发送测试推送通知的功能

当我做广播时,一切正常。但当我尝试用标签发送时,什么也没发生

我试图通过.NET对象发送带有特定标记的消息,它也可以正常工作,标记列表和标记表达式都可以正常工作

string tagsExpr = "mytag";
NotificationHubClient hub = NotificationHubClient.CreateClientFromConnectionString(notificationHubConnection, notificationHubName);
hub.SendTemplateNotificationAsync(templateParams, tagsExpr);

该字段中是否有特定格式的标记?我找不到任何相关信息。

在您的第一个屏幕截图中,我们可以发现您向Azure portal中的Android平台发送了一个测试通知,您说没有任何设备收到该通知。请确保使用
mytag
的GCM本机注册在注册列表中


没有,没有特定的格式。尝试发送广播,然后按标签发送,然后再次广播。如果第二次广播尝试无法发送任何内容,则可能是令牌问题。该标记下有多少设备?Test send随机发送10个,因此您正在检查的设备可能不在这10个设备中。除此之外,请检查注册是否确实具有与其关联的标记。正如我所说,通过广播和带有标签的.NET应用程序,一切正常。